Phillip Gene "Phil" Ruffin (born March 14, 1935) is an American businessman. He owns the Treasure Island Hotel and Casino in Las Vegas. He is also a business partner of Donald Trump, with whom he co-owns the Trump International Hotel in Las Vegas.

On the Forbes 2018 list of the world's billionaires, he was ranked No. 877 with a net worth of US $2.7 billion.[1][2]
